Harwich Town is a straightforward train station, perfect for no-fuss travelers. The absence of a ticket office and ticket machines means passengers should plan ahead and book tickets online, making use of accessible ticket machines at nearby stations if needed. But fear not — there's a helpful customer information point, outfitted with staff assistance and departure screens to guide your journey.
Despite the station's simplicity, accessibility is a priority. Step-free access is available to the platforms, and there is an induction loop for those with hearing aids to ensure that everyone can travel with confidence. However, be prepared as there are no onsite refreshment facilities, shops, or ATMs, so bringing your essentials before arrival is advised.
Harwich Town ensures you can transition smoothly from train to bus. Rail replacement services and local buses operate from the station's forecourt, requiring only a brief walk from the platform. Unfortunately, there is no dedicated cycle hire, nor a long-term car park, though limited free parking spaces are provided. This might make public transportation especially appealing if you're exploring the town.
For those traveling with extra needs, while there are no wheelchair loans or accessible taxis, trains are equipped with accessible features to ease boarding and alighting.

This station offers a broad array of amenities catering to convenience and accessibility. Though there isn't a ticket office, ticket machines are available. These machines support the collection of tickets purchased online and are fully accessible to all customers. You'll find an induction loop and several help points to ensure you have all the support you need, with departure screens and announcements to keep you informed. Step-free access is available throughout the entire station, ensuring an inclusive travel experience.
While Custom House station lacks a waiting room or first-class lounge, covered seating areas on platforms A and B provide comfort while waiting for your train. The station is well-equipped with accessible toilets located within the ticket hall. It's worth noting that the station doesn't have luggage storage facilities or shops, so be sure to come prepared for your journey.
Custom House station integrates seamlessly with London's extensive public transport network, offering diverse onward travel options. Transport for London buses operate from outside the station, allowing easy connections to various parts of the city. The London Underground, along with the Docklands Light Railway (DLR), is accessible, ensuring quick transfers to other lines. For those flying, services to Heathrow Terminals 2, 3, 4, and 5 run from the station, making your airport transfer hassle-free.
